Stewart To Father Superman?

By Michelle
August 26, 2004 - 8:21 AM

Patrick Stewart, who went from fame as Star Trek: The Next Generation's Captain Picard to The X-Men's Professor Xavier, may be in the running for another coveted franchise role: that of Jor-El in the new Superman film.

Cinescape reported on a story from IESB.net saying that according to a source, Stewart is the first choice of director Bryan Singer to play Superman's father.

Singer, Stewart's X-Men director, allegedly wants to cast well-known actors in the supporting roles with an unknown playing Superman, following in the footsteps of Christopher Reeve from previous films and Tom Welling in the current series Smallville. Welling is also rumoured to be in the running to star in the upcoming film.

Legendary actor Marlon Brando played Jor-El, the Kryptonian scientist who sent his son Kal-El to Earth when his planet faced destruction, opposite Reeve.

Neither Singer nor Stewart has commented upon this rumour. The original Cinescape article is here, following up on the original story from IESB.net.
